Core parameters: Rockchip RK3568 quad-core SoC, 22 nm process, integrated 1 TOPS NPU. CPU 4x ARM Cortex-A55 @ 2.0 GHz, 64-bit. GPU Arm Mali-G52 2EE GPU, OpenGL ES 3.2 / OpenCL 2.0 / Vulkan 1.1. NPU 1 TOPS INT8 NPU for ID card OCR, face verification assistance and queue analytics. Video decode Hardware 4K@60fps H.265 / H.264 / VP9 decode, 1080p60 H.264 encode. ISP 8 MP ISP with MIPI-CSI camera pipeline for document scan and face verification modules. Memory and storage 4GB LPDDR4 + 64GB eMMC. Operating system Android 11 / Android 12 with GMS option, Linux (Debian / Ubuntu) and Buildroot. Display output Dual independent display via LVDS + eDP + HDMI 2.0 + MIPI-DSI, up to 4K@60 on HDMI. Interfaces and I/O USB 3.0 x2 + USB 2.0 x4, RS232 x4 / RS485 x2, GPIO / I2C / SPI / CAN bus, relay and digital I/O. Networking Dual Gigabit Ethernet + WiFi 6 (802.11ax) + Bluetooth 5.0 + optional 4G LTE module. Power input DC 12 V input, 9-36 V wide voltage optional. Operating temperature 0 to 60 deg C commercial, -20 to 70 deg C extended. Board dimensions Pico-ITX 100 x 72 mm / 3.5-inch SBC 146 x 102 mm / Mini-ITX 170 x 170 mm. Certifications CE / FCC / RoHS / REACH. ID and Biometric Identity Terminal Boards Application Scenarios across Deployment Sites

Deployment notes below come from live ID and Biometric Identity Terminal Boards sites on several continents, each with unit count and measured result.

Scenario 1: ID issuance with iris capture for remote applicants (Iloilo, Philippines). A regional office installed 12 units combining an iris scanner, a document camera and a receipt printer, batching records for upload once the link returns. Measured result: failed captures in low-light halls fell 57% and applicant revisits dropped 41%.

Scenario 2: ID card verification at a citizen service desk (Zagreb, Croatia). An agency installed 34 units with a board reading national ID cards over USB, capturing a live face frame on a MIPI-CSI camera and holding the match on-device so no template leaves the terminal. Measured result: identity check time fell from 96 to 21 seconds and manual review escalations fell 44%.

Scenario 3: secure login for a public library network (Espoo, Finland). A city network installed 26 units using card plus PIN plus face, with secure boot, an encrypted keystore and a full audit trail written locally. Measured result: account-sharing incidents fell to zero across three quarters and help-desk password resets dropped 51%.

Scenario 4: multi-factor staff access in a public building (Graz, Austria). A building operator deployed 18 units combining badge, fingerprint and face factors, with a relay output driving the door and GPIO inputs reporting door state. Measured result: tailgating incidents reported by security fell 39% and access log completeness reached 100%.

Scenario 5: biometric enrolment vans for rural districts (Lahore, Pakistan). A service provider fitted 40 vehicle-mounted units with fanless boards, a wide-voltage input, a 4G link and an on-device queue cache for sites with no fixed line. Measured result: daily enrolments per van rose from 210 to 470 and sync conflicts after connectivity loss fell to zero.

What is the difference between OEM and ODM for ID and Biometric Identity Terminal Boards?

Answer: O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er) means Wanlin Group builds the government service board, self-service terminal controller or finished public-service kiosk under your brand with your PCB silk-screen, logo, packaging and SKU. ODM (Original Design Manufacturer) means we redesign the carrier board, memory and storage combination, I/O set, touch interface, firmware or enclosure around your project. Both run from the same Shenzhen factory and the same firmware team: OEM lead time is 20-30 days and ODM 30-45 days including pre-compliance checks. Schematic review, custom carrier layout, AOSP or Linux build work, touch driver tuning and certification support are provided under NDA.

What software support comes with the boards?

Answer: Every board ships with Android images alongside Linux support (Android 11 / Android 12 with GMS option, Linux (Debian / Ubuntu) and Buildroot), BSP source access, driver documentation, SDK material and OTA tooling. The Android builds ship with GMS / Play Store where the destination market and product category qualify; for markets or projects that do not need Google services, the same hardware runs a full AOSP or Linux build, which also lowers unit cost. Kiosk-mode launchers, auto-start app configuration, scheduled power on and off, idle reset for demo units and remote content agents are part of the standard integration work. The AI path uses RKNN Toolkit2 and RKNPU2 SDK for ID card OCR, face verification and document recognition where the project needs on-device inference.

Can the board drive two screens and the full kiosk peripheral set?

Answer: Yes. Dual independent display via LVDS + eDP + HDMI 2.0 + MIPI-DSI, up to 4K@60 on HDMI. The peripheral stack covers thermal, receipt and A4 document printers on RS232 or USB, ID card and passport readers on USB or serial, fingerprint and iris scanners on USB, face verification modules on USB or MIPI-CSI, signature pads, barcode and QR scanners, card dispensers, document feeders and electronic seal modules on serial or USB, plus speakers, amplifiers and microphones on the audio path and ambient sensors on I2C. Drivers ship with the image; if a peripheral is not yet in our driver library, our firmware team writes and validates the driver as part of the ODM scope.
